I've just about got the 408 together. Everything is speced and clearanced properly. Have 7 pistons in the hole, broke a ring on the eighth (pissed my off i can tell ya). Got the rings in today so should have the bottom end buttoned up tonight or tomorrow. Then just a matter of bolting everything on. Waiting on my intake too, backordered. Here's the goods so far:

DSS Dart 351 Block
Eagle Forged Crank and Rods
SRP Nascar Foirged Pistons
Custom Comp Cam
TFS CNC Ported Highport Race Heads
TFS Box R Intake Manifold
Melling Hiflow Oil Pump
Canton 7 qt pan

She's running 8.85:1 compression right now, waiting to see some serious boost :D . I'm gonna by the YSI trim at the end of Summer or over the Winter for next year. Doubt I'll be able to piece it together this year. Can't wait to see what she'll do. I'm getting excited. Won't be super strong with the low compression but should still put some decent ponies down. I was actually going to go turbo but the car is being built for a lot of bracket racing. In my experience turbo cars are better for heads up classes. They just aren't as consistent. As for the Procharger I have two friends with them and they have had nothing but problems with them. Seals seem to always go. One has had his P1SC in twice to Procharger for overhauls. I've heard good things about the YSI's so I thought I'd go that route. I don't really want to buy used. Thanks for the info though. I'll check out NMRA just for fun.
